Summary of Changes

Hello @deluan, I'm Gemini Code Assist1! I'm currently reviewing this pull request and will post my feedback shortly. In the meantime, here's a summary to help you and other reviewers quickly get up to speed!

This pull request introduces new API functionality to allow users to update specific aspects of their play queue (like current track or position) or clear it entirely, in addition to the existing ability to replace the whole queue. This involved extending the data repository interface and implementation to support partial updates and clearing, and adding new API handlers and tests.

Highlights

  • New API Endpoints: I've added two new endpoints to the native API for managing the user's play queue: PUT /queue for updating specific fields and DELETE /queue for clearing the entire queue.
  • Partial Queue Updates: The PlayQueueRepository.Store method has been modified to support partial updates. It now accepts optional column names, allowing callers (like the new PUT endpoint) to specify which fields (items, current, position) should be updated without replacing the entire queue. If no columns are specified, it behaves like the previous full replacement.
  • Repository Interface & Implementation: The model.PlayQueueRepository interface and its persistence implementation have been extended to include a Clear method, used by the new DELETE endpoint, and the Store method signature was updated to support partial updates.
  • Payload Struct Reuse: The queuePayload struct was renamed to updateQueuePayload and its fields made optional (pointers with omitempty) so it can be reused for both the POST /queue (full save) and PUT /queue (partial update) endpoints.
  • New Tests: Comprehensive tests have been added for the new PUT /queue and DELETE /queue endpoints, covering successful operations and error cases, and existing POST /queue tests were updated to use the new payload struct.
